Aerospace Engineering Meets Pool Care
The TVC engine isn't just marketing hype—it transforms maneuverability and suction power fundamentally. Traditional robots rely on basic propeller designs that struggle with corners and steps, but Aiper's turbine vectoring system creates targeted water jets that dislodge stubborn debris. During testing, this engineering enabled complete wall traversing in under 10 seconds where competitors took 30+ seconds. More crucially, the adaptive cleaning algorithm adjusts power based on detected filth levels. If your pool has heavy post-storm debris, it automatically boosts suction rather than just extending runtime like cheaper models.

HydroConnect Water Intelligence
Aiper's 5-in-1 HydroConnect device solves the guesswork in water maintenance. Solar-powered and app-connected, it monitors:
- Real-time chlorine/pH levels
- Water temperature (no more shocking cold plunges)
- Particulate density
- Chemical imbalance alerts
The system's true innovation is predictive maintenance. When it detects rising phosphate levels—a precursor to algae—it automatically recommends shock treatments through the app. This proactive approach prevents 80% of common pool problems according to Water Quality Association guidelines. Unlike basic monitors, HydroConnect syncs with your cleaner, allowing remote recall during thunderstorms or when guests arrive.
Complete Spatial Awareness
Where most robots blindly bump into walls, the Pro Max uses LiDAR mapping to:
- Memorize ladder/step locations
- Avoid entanglement hazards
- Distinguish between floors/walls/surface
- Optimize cleaning paths dynamically
During the demo, the unit seamlessly transitioned from scrubbing tiles to waterline skimming without manual intervention. The dual-robot setup (floor + full-pool units) works like a coordinated team, with the surface unit specifically targeting pollen and leaves before they sink. For vinyl pool owners, this prevents the abrasive damage caused by floor-only cleaners dragging surface debris downward.

Hassle-Free Maintenance System
Three design choices dramatically reduce upkeep time:
- Wireless charging caddy: No more wet plugs or tangled cords. Just dock the robot for automatic power transfer.
- Top-loading 3-micron filters: Easily removable baskets capture particles smaller than a grain of sand (most competitors filter only 5-10 microns). Each holds 7 liters of debris—triple standard capacity.
- Hybrid controls: While the app offers advanced scheduling, physical buttons provide reliability during connectivity issues. This dual-interface approach accommodates both tech-savvy users and those preferring tactile feedback.
Real-World Performance Considerations
Though the Pro Max excels in daily maintenance, our analysis suggests two limitations:
- Large debris handling: Like all robotic cleaners, palm fronds may require manual removal
- Steep investment: At ~$1,500, it's best suited for medium-to-large pools where its automation delivers ROI through reduced chemical use and professional service costs
For smaller pools, Aiper's single-robot models offer similar tech at lower price points. However, the Pro Max's adaptive suction and dual-unit system justify the premium for pools over 20,000 gallons.
